Dear all

I've been running CC Desktop app happily for a number of years, and suddenly 2 days ago I'm getting a P50 error when it's trying to initialise after booting up my PC.

I've tried uninstalling, reinstalling but I also get P50 errors when trying to reinstall.

I don't want to remove all of my programs and start a complete reinstall of all my apps.

My question is do I really need the CC Desktop App to use my CC programs (primarily Dreamweaver, Photoshop and InDesign)? Can I not update programs direct from the Adobe website and add fonts from TypeKit by logging into my account via a browser?

Yes it is needed, it automatically installs when you download your first Creative Cloud application. It serves many purposes, the most primary among them would be to manage the licensing of your software, so you can't do away with this.
